Lake County, Oregon Population 2026
Updated April 2026 · US Census ACS 2023 5-Year Estimates · 30th-largest in Oregon
The population of Lake County, Oregon is 8,254 as of the 2023 American Community Survey, making it the 30th-largest county in Oregon. The median household income is $61,222, the median home value is $219,400, and the median age is 45.9.
The population of Lake County has grown 4.1% since 2010 (7,875 → 8,194), a +0.28% annualized rate.

About Lake County, OR
Lake County is a county in Oregon with a population of 8,254. It ranks #30 among counties in Oregon by population. The median age is 45.9, older than the national median. The population is 54.0% male and 46.0% female.
The median household income in Lake County is $61,222, below the US median of $74,580. 8.6% of residents live below the federal poverty level. Home values sit at a median of $219,400, with monthly rent averaging $861. The homeownership rate of 61.5% is lower than the national rate of 64.8%.
Educational attainment in Lake County reflects 20.9% of adults 25 and older holding a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national average of 34.3%. Roughly 10.5% of workers primarily work from home, below the national work-from-home rate of 14.2%. The average commute is 15.1 minutes each way.
Lake County Population History (2010-2024)
The county of Lake County had a population of 7,875 in 2010 and 8,194 in 2024, a 4.1% growth over 14 years. The peak was 8,365 in 2022. Average annual growth rate: 0.29%.

| Year | Population |
|---|---|
| 2010 | 7,875 |
| 2011 | 7,908 |
| 2012 | 7,789 |
| 2013 | 7,800 |
| 2014 | 7,828 |
| 2015 | 7,789 |
| 2016 | 7,837 |
| 2017 | 7,892 |
| 2018 | 7,861 |
| 2019 | 7,939 |
| 2020 | 8,174 |
| 2021 | 8,294 |
| 2022 | 8,365 |
| 2023 | 8,307 |
| 2024 | 8,194 |
